The eligibility criteria to get admission in MSc Astronomy varies from college to college. But generally, it is that the candidate must have atleast 55%  marks in average and above in a bachelor’s degree. And candidate must have completed a bachelor’s degree in science (physics, mathematics, astrophysics or astronomy). Also, it depends on the college as well if the college take admissions by entrance test or not. To know more, visit here:
